<p>Hi Max,</p>
<p>it's the sasl logging that includes compete state info on a process crash that can cause the out of memory situation. The error_logger itself is not at fault.</p>
<p>Of course, the too_big_to_fail flag will get around the sasl deficiency. Roll on R18.</p>
<p>Robby</p>
<div class="gmail_quote">On Apr 1, 2013 9:16 AM, "Max Lapshin" <<a href="mailto:max.lapshin@gmail.com">max.lapshin@gmail.com</a>> wrote:<br type="attribution"><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">
<div dir="ltr"><div class="gmail_extra">Nice joke, of course, but still the main reason for erlang application to fail is error_logger process.</div><div class="gmail_extra"><br></div><div class="gmail_extra">
Every blog post about erlang starts from word "it is rock solid, everything is restarted", but when buggy error_logger is killed after eating 10 Gig of RAM, then whole erlang system is down.</div><div class="gmail_extra">

<br></div><div class="gmail_extra">I don't understand what is the problem in restarting error_logger</div></div>
<br>_______________________________________________<br>
erlang-questions mailing list<br>
<a href="mailto:erlang-questions@erlang.org">erlang-questions@erlang.org</a><br>
<a href="http://erlang.org/mailman/listinfo/erlang-questions" target="_blank">http://erlang.org/mailman/listinfo/erlang-questions</a><br>
<br></blockquote></div>